Rent the perfect carAn easy 5-mile drive from Ocala's city center, 'The Appleton' is an iconic art museum in Central Florida. Since 1987, the Appleton Museum of Art has grown to a collection of over 24,000 permanent objects along with outdoor sculptures and rotating temporary exhibitions. Spanning over 81,610 square feet, it's the perfect day out for art lovers and families alike.
Hit the road for 7 miles, and you'll reach Silver Springs State Park, Florida's first tourist attraction. Explore one of the latest springs in the US with a glass-bottom boat tour or enjoy one of the many water activities available on these crystal clear waters, from kayaking to stand-up paddleboarding. Plus, there are plenty of scenic hiking opportunities ranging from under one mile to a rewarding 4.1-mile loop.
Tackle the sprawling equestrian trails of Cross Florida Greenway with a horseback riding experience. Take the easy 50-minute drive from Ocala, and book in for a day of trail riding fun. Start with a relaxed two-track woods trail or tackle the challenging single-track trails if you're a more experienced rider. You'll find companies like Cactus Jacks Trail Rides offering guided horseback riding tours in the area.

Rest assured that most main roads across Florida are wide and straight, with the Sunshine State filled with plenty of scenic driving roads, perfect for every driver. Don't miss the picturesque horse farms and tree-lined roads located West and North West of Ocala in horse country.
Driving conditions in Ocala tend to be smooth, but traffic and road congestion are common. Several major roads in and around Ocala are known for heavy traffic, including Interstate 75, US Route 301, and Florida State Road. Plus, State Road 200 is known for heavy traffic during peak hours (6:00 am to 9:00 am and 3:00 pm to 7:00 pm).
When driving through Ocala and the rest of Florida, remember to drive on the right side of the road, follow the legal speed limits, ensure seat belts are worn at all times, and never drink and drive. Florida's legal alcohol limit is under .08, so always nominate a designated driver.
Throughout the city center of Ocala, you'll find plenty of free parking spaces, including spots within the Downtown Parking Garage. There are also two new public parking lots in the city center, including Parking Lot 5 (northeast corner of North Magnolia Avenue and Northeast First Street) or Parking Lot 9 (northeast corner of West Fort King Street and Southwest First Avenue).
Yes, there are toll roads in Ocala. The Florida Turnpike (connecting Ocala to Homestead) is a major interstate highway known for its tolls. If you plan to venture further afield in Florida, you'll also find tolls on Alligator Alley (1-75 from Miami to Naples) and the Bee Line Expressway (from Orlando to Cape Canaveral).
There are plenty of places to fill up your rental vehicle in Ocala. You'll find gas stations like RaceTrac and Shell located on major roads, such as E Silver Springs Blvd, S Pine Ave and SW College Road.
For drivers renting an electric car, you'll find EV charging stations like a Tesla Supercharger and Blink Charging Station throughout Ocala. Head to SW College Road, W Silver Springs Blvd or N Pine Ave for a range of EV charging options, many open 24 hours.
While the historic streets of downtown Ocala are very walkable, rental cars are the best way to explore Ocala and the rest of Florida. Many of the best natural landmarks and attractions are located at least an hour's drive from Ocala Downtown. Plus, renting your own car ensures you're not limited to the SunTran bus timetable.
To rent a car on Turo, you must create a Turo account, have a valid driver’s license, get approved to drive on Turo, and be 18 years old or older in the US, 21 years old or older in Australia, or 23 years old or older in Canada.
In the UK, you must be 21 years old or older and have held a UK or EU license for at least one year, or another driver’s license for at least two years. In France you must be 18 years old or older and have held a driver’s license for at least 2 years, longer for certain makes and models of vehicles.
When you’re booking your first trip, you’ll go through a quick approval process by entering your driver’s license and some other information. In most cases, you’ll get approved immediately, and you’ll be set for all future road trips, day trips, and business trips!
Turo accepts valid licenses (not expired, suspended, or revoked) that allow for full driving privileges; this includes driver’s licenses issued outside of the US. Licenses that Turo doesn’t accept in the US include any that have expired, have been altered, are conditional, probational, provisional, or restricted. Learner’s permit/instruction permits are not accepted.
To rent a car on Turo in the US, you must be 18 years old or older.

Yes, multiple guests can drive the car you rent on Turo, as long as they are all approved to drive. The primary driver (whoever rented the car) can add additional drivers with no fees or additional charges. Only the primary driver can request to add drivers; Turo hosts cannot do it for you. We encourage you to request to add additional drivers before your trip starts, though guests can request to add a driver while a trip is in progress.
To speed up the process, have your additional driver create a Turo account and get approved to drive before you request to add them. All drivers must have a valid driver’s license and meet the age requirements for the car you’ve booked. You can request to add drivers via the “Trips” tab in the Turo app without additional driver charges or extra costs.
